The value of Jesus in salvation.
Who is Jesus Christ to you and of what value?
If a stranger gives you a million dollars without wanting anything in return other than that you live a wholesome, moral life, how often would you call that person to say thank you? Daily or monthly won't be enough, Perhaps you would ensure this kind hearted person receives a beautiful, handwritten lovely messages every week. Maybe you would email him weekly to let him know how thankful you are and how wisely you are investing the money and all of the charitable things you are doing with it, That person would certainly be celebrated in your life and household. Imagine the delight of telling your family that you have been provided for, without complicated clauses or terms. It would be easy to break out in cheers and jumps for joy whenever you remembers him.
Jesus Christ our savior took on the burden of not only you but all mankind, he didn't give us a million dollars; he cleared up EVERYONE's debts forever and placed a value that can never be estimated in our lives. we should always Rejoice in knowing that JESUS CHRIST has paid for our salvation by reconciling us with God through his death on the cross. Celebrating him by living a righteous life is the best appreciation you can show for this great sacrifice.
